The other day I was reading about cleaner wrasses. These are the fish, usually in coral reef community, that establish a place of business, and other fishes who want to be rid of parasites come onto location to be cleaned. They allow the wrasses to nip them all over to get the pests taken care of, even allowing the smaller fish to swim into their mouths to work their specialization there. Kind of a mix between a visit to the dentist and the car wash. Documentary makers have filmed the process multiple times, and, being humans, we project onto the piscine scene a kind of business template—an exchange of goods for services. And we assume that’s all there is to know. Consider that when you want to spot the Pleiades in the nighttime sky, the best way to do it is not to look directly at the constellation. Our rods, which are far more sensitive than our cones, are not concentrated in the center of our field of vision. That means, in some circumstances, you see something better by looking slightly away from it. Don’t take my word for it, test it yourself on a clear night.

We also know that some animals have senses that we don’t. When’s the last time you picked up the earth’s magnetic field? We know it’s there and we know that some animals sense it. We don’t. There are several key players in the drama of how we’ve come to our current understanding of the weather, but one that surprised me most was Robert FitzRoy. Everyone knows that FitzRoy was captain of the Beagle on Charles Darwin’s voyage that revolutionized science for ever. Some are even aware that FitzRoy, especially after his marriage, because a staunch evangelical Christian, parting ways with Darwin so far as to wave a Bible over his head at a public debate on evolution. I, for one, had no idea that FitzRoy almost singlehandedly invented the weather forecast. And that he did so as a government employee and doing so brought the ridicule of the scientific establishment because predicting was considered the purview of unscientific minds. What is really ironic is that evolution has become the line in the sand between biblical literalists and science. As de Waal points out, the idea that people are different from the animals from which they evolved—in some qualitative way—is an idea based on religion. Many scientists still hold to it in a way that can only be described as, well, religious. This is very strange when evolution works by gradual changes over long periods of time. When did humans gain whatever trait that separates them from “the animals”? When I was a child it was tool use. When that was disproved, it became language. When that was disproved it became consciousness. The latter is the safest since nobody really knows what it is. As de Waal amply demonstrates the Behaviorist school was clearly wrong about animals (including humans). What no Behaviorist wants to admit is that the idea that we alone are conscious comes from the cultural interpretation of the Bible.

Are We Smart Enough to Know How Smart Animals Are? is, like many of de Waal’s books, full of wonderful observations of the ways animals actually behave. They solve problems. They learn from experience. They anticipate the future. In some cases they have been shown to outperform humans on cognitive tasks. And yet we still insist that people are somehow different. Better.
